三端互通独立服务器:构建无缝跨终端体验的新一代解决方案
文章大纲
- 技术深度分析:三端互通与独立服务器核心架构
- 五大关键优势:实时同步与安全控制能力解析
- 实践应用场景:游戏协同·教育平台·企业协作
- 实施四步流程:从环境配置到持续运维
- 行业趋势前瞻:边缘计算与AI驱动的未来方向
- 核心问题解疑:实时性·成本·安全专项问答
技术深度分析:三端互通与独立服务器核心架构
三端互通独立服务器通过统一架构实现PC、移动端及网页平台的深度整合。核心采用分布式微服务设计,结合WebSocket长连接协议确保数据实时交互。典型结构分为三层:接入层动态分配终端请求,逻辑层处理业务规则,数据层借助Redis集群实现跨平台状态同步。关键在于统一身份验证系统,通过OAuth2.0协议让用户在切换设备时保持会话连续性。
数据同步机制采用差异增量传输技术,仅同步变更内容。例如游戏场景中角色位置信息,通过坐标压缩算法将传输量降低90%。容灾设计采用多可用区部署,当华东节点故障时自动切换到华南备份集群,保障99.95%服务可用率。
五大关键优势:实时同步与安全控制能力解析
毫秒级交互响应:实测数据显示,在同城骨干网环境下,三端互通独立服务器实现移动端到PC端数据延迟低于50ms。教育应用中师生教学工具操作可实时同步呈现。
安全合规保障:独立部署模式满足等保2.0要求,金融级数据传输采用国密SM4加密,操作日志留存180天以上。2023年某电商平台实践案例显示,私有化部署后数据泄露风险降低87%。
资源动态调配:容器化架构支持按终端流量弹性扩缩容。大型游戏版本更新期间自动增加30%计算节点,业务高峰过后自动释放冗余资源。
跨平台兼容技术解决渲染适配难题,OpenGL指令集转换为iOS Metal指令的效率达98%。用户体验层面消除不同设备间的操作割裂感。某上市企业在采用统一服务器后协作效率提升40%。
实践应用场景:游戏协同·教育平台·企业协作
游戏行业变革:《幻界远征》实现PC玩家与手机用户同服竞技,日活突破300万。其核心在于独立服务器统一物理引擎计算,确保手机端玩家发射的子弹轨迹与PC端完全一致。
教育数字化转型:学堂云平台通过三端互通支撑100万学生跨终端学习。直播教学模块采用分层编码技术,网络带宽波动时自动适配画质保持教学连续性。
企业级应用部署:制造业MES系统整合产线PAD终端与管理者PC看板,设备状态实时同步精度达毫秒级。三一重工实践显示,生产异常响应时效缩短至传统模式的1/5。
实施四步流程:从环境配置到持续运维
基础架构构建:采用Dell PowerEdge R750机架式服务器集群,搭配NVIDIA T4计算卡。网络拓扑采用双万兆光纤接入,核心交换机配置BGP协议实现多线接入。
同步系统开发:数据管道基于Apache Kafka构建,消息分发延迟控制在10ms内。开发适配层处理不同终端SDK对接,iOS端集成SwiftUI框架,Web端采用WebAssembly优化性能。
安全加固阶段:部署硬件防火墙开启DDoS防护能力。系统层面设置端口最小化开放策略,应用层实施OWASP标准防护方案。
持续运维机制:建立终端性能监控大盘,对Android低端机型启动自动降级策略。设计灰度发布流程支持AB测试,配置管理中心实现参数热更新。
行业趋势前瞻:边缘计算与AI驱动的未来方向
5G网络演进推动边缘节点部署成为关键发展方向。通过设置地市级计算节点将延迟进一步压降到10ms内。京东云实践案例显示,区域边缘节点可减轻中心服务器70%流量压力。
AI技术强化跨端体验,智能预加载系统分析用户操作习惯,提前同步下一场景数据。2024年《全球互联报告》预测,采用AI预测算法的三端系统资源占用率将降低45%。未来量子加密技术有望提升数据传输安全维度。
核心问题解疑:实时性·成本·安全专项问答
问题1:三端设备延迟差异如何优化?
答案:采用网络状态感知策略,动态调整传输频率。当检测到手机网络波动时自动切换到UDP轻量传输协议,通过路径优化算法降低25%延迟波动。
问题2:中小团队能否负担独立服务器成本?
答案:采用混合云架构平衡成本与性能。核心事务处理在私有服务器完成,日志分析等非实时任务部署公有云。实际案例显示20人团队年度成本可控制在15万元内。
问题3:如何防御跨终端数据劫持?
答案:实施双向证书认证机制,每个终端具备唯一设备指纹。传输层部署量子随机数加密密钥,每次会话更换新密钥。安全审计系统实时扫描异常数据包特征。
问题4:终端兼容性问题的技术策略?
答案:设计设备能力矩阵数据库,动态加载适配模块。低配设备启用指令集裁剪模式,保留核心功能框架。测试环节需覆盖Android 8.0以上全量机型。
问题5:数据冲突处理的最佳实践?
答案:采用事务版本号标记机制(Vector Clock),冲突发生时按照时间戳和操作优先级智能合并。关键业务数据设置修改锁,确保唯一操作终端。